Output 453e3ef8025725b53de710932f8f19166ed9bfca6d0e32ef17f7e6cf1882eee3:27

value
384000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58aeac578a03aa246eb3d7b7861b3f02a3cddad0 OP_EQUAL
address
39mvdw2SjDoDwUSqzEUiGgYGWvo4n1qVXj
transaction
453e3ef8025725b53de710932f8f19166ed9bfca6d0e32ef17f7e6cf1882eee3
spent
true